E51: Jesus and the Bruised Reed
from After the Amen Podcast · host Myles Hester and Benjamin Lee
SummaryIn this conversation, Benjamin Lee explores the reasons behind Jesus' command to keep miracles secret, emphasizing the fulfillment of prophecy and the compassionate nature of Jesus' ministry. He discusses the significance of the bruised reed and smoldering wick as metaphors for those in need of encouragement and support. The conversation highlights the importance of viewing others with compassion and the call to action for individuals to be helpers in their communities, reflecting Jesus' love and grace.TakeawaysJesus often told those he healed not to share their stories to fulfill prophecy.Isaiah 42 provides insight into Jesus' humble approach to ministry.Jesus came to help and encourage those who are hurting.The bruised reed and smoldering wick symbolize those in need of care.Compassion is essential in how we view and treat others.We should encourage and support our families and friends.Jesus' ministry was focused on seeking and saving the lost.We must be patient and kind to those who are struggling.Encouragement is vital in the Christian community.Today is the day for individuals to seek salvation.
